发明名称 METHOD FOR BLEACHING PAPER PULP

A method for bleaching raw paper pulps with organic peracids, characterized in that it is carried out in two steps at atmospheric pressure and at a temperature of less than or equal to 100 degree C, wherein: the first step is carried out by bringing the raw pulp into contact with a mixture of peracetic acid and performic acid so that the mixture obtained has a water content of less than or equal to 15% by weight; the second step is carried out by treating the bleached pulp obtained, after mechanical separation of the reaction medium obtained at the end of the first step, with a solution of sodium hydroxide and hydrogen peroxide. 2. The method as claimed in claim 1, characterized in that the peracetic acid and the performic acid are obtained by bringing a mixture of acetic acid and formic acid into contact with hydrogen peroxide having a concentration greater than 50% by weight. 3. The method as claimed in any one of claims 1 to 2, characterized in that the acetic acid + peracetic acid/formic acid + performic acid ratio is of the order of 9/1 by volume. 4. The method as claimed in any one of claims 1 to 3, characterized in that the quantity of peracids at the beginning of the first step is greater than or equal to 20% by weight. 5. The method as claimed in any one of claims 1 to 4, characterized in that the raw pulps are brought into contact with the mixture of peracids counter current wise with recirculation of the peracids. 6. The method as claimed in any one of claims 1 to 5, characterized in that the solution of peracids after the first bleaching step is enriched with peracids so as to bring the concentration of peracids to the chosen value. 7. The method as claimed in any one of claims 1 to 6, characterized in that the pulps treated during the first step are separated from the peracids by pressing. 8. The method as claimed in any one of claims 1 to 7, characterized in that the pressed pulps are deacidified by drying under vacuum, leaving residual hydrogen peroxide in the pulp. 9. The method as claimed in any one of claims 1 to 8, characterized in that the contact time between the peracids and the raw pulp is between 1 hour and 3 hours. 10. The method as claimed in any one of claims 1 to 9, characterized in that the treatment temperature is between 60 degree C and 90 degree C. 11. The method as claimed in any one of claims 1 to 10, characterized in that the second step is carried out by bringing the deacidified pulp into contact with a basic aqueous solution (pH between 8 and 10) containing 1 to 4% by weight of hydrogen peroxide (calculated relative to the dry pulp). 12. The method as claimed in any one of claims 1 to 11, characterized in that the contact time between the pulp and the hydrogen peroxide in a basic medium is between 1 h and 3 h. 13. The method as claimed in any one of claims 1 to 12, characterized in that the pulps obtained during the second step are, after pressing, washed with demineralized water. 14. The method as claimed in any one of claims 1 to 13, characterized in that the water introduced, by the raw pulp, on the one hand, and the hydrogen peroxide, on the other hand, is extracted from the cycle by distillation. 15. A paper pulp, obtained according to the method of claims 1 to 14 having a brightness value greater than 70. 16. A paper, manufactured using a pulp in accordance with claim 15.
